2

HTTP-клиенты, такие как веб-браузеры, добавляли http: схему к URL-адресам, когда пользователь вводит example.com не будучи очень конкретным. Это приведет к запросу на http://example.com/ .

Можно ли заставить Firefox использовать https: вместо этого так, чтобы example.com записывался как https://example.com/? При явном запросе http://example.com/ его не следует переписывать.

2 ответа2

2

Используйте HTTPS по умолчанию надстройка: https://addons.mozilla.org/en-US/firefox/addon/https-by-default

Если схема ("http:") не указана, аддон предполагает, что вы хотите перейти на https-версию сайта. Если сайт не доступен через https, отображается обычная страница ошибок Firefox. Если сайт не поддерживает https, отредактируйте URL в адресной строке, удалите "s" в https и повторите попытку.

(раскрытие: я разработал этот аддон, его исходный код доступен по адресу https://github.com/Rob--W/https-by-default)

2

Похоже, вам нужен плагин HTTPS Everywhere от EFF. Или, если вы работаете с сервером, вы могли бы обслуживать заголовок Strict-Transport-Security: max-age=31536000 через HTTPS. Это заставит браузеры использовать HTTPS для этого сервера на следующий год.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.